Prep and Cook Time

Prep Time: 10 ⁣minutes
Cook​ time: ⁣15 minutes
Total Time: ‍ 25 minutes

Yield

4 hearty‌ servings

Difficulty⁢ Level

Easy – perfect for ⁣quick dinners or⁢ weekend ​indulgences

ingredients

  • 1 pound pre-cooked⁤ Italian-style meatballs (beef, pork, or plant-based)
  • 3 cups ​marinara sauce (homemade or high-quality store-bought)
  • 4 sub rolls, lightly⁢ toasted
  • 8⁤ slices provolone ‌cheese
  • 2⁣ tablespoons olive oil
  • 1⁢ small yellow ⁤onion, ⁤finely chopped
  • 2 garlic‍ cloves, minced
  • 1 ​teaspoon ​d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on red pepper‍ flakes ⁢(optional, for subtle heat)
  • Fresh basil leaves for garnish
  • Salt and black⁣ p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. Warm the olive⁢ oil in a large ‍skillet⁢ over medium heat. Add the finely chopped onion​ and sauté until translucent and fragrant, ​about 5‌ minutes. Stir occasionally⁢ to avoid browning.
  2. Add the minced garlic, ​dried ‌oregano, and red⁢ pepper flakes if using. Cook for 1 minute until garlic releases its aroma.
  3. Pour in the ‌marinara‌ sauce, stirring to combine ‌with the‍ aromatics. simmer on low heat for 5 minutes, allowing flavors⁤ to meld ⁤and ⁢thicken slightly.
  4. Gently add the pre-cooked meatballs ⁣ to the skillet. Simmer in the marinara for 7-8 ‌minutes, turning occasionally to coat meatballs thoroughly ‌and heat​ them‍ thru.
  5. Split the sub rolls ‍ horizontally without cutting ​all the ⁢way ⁢through,⁣ creating a cradle for the filling. Toast⁢ briefly ⁤if desired for ⁢added texture.
  6. Spoon‍ the ⁢saucy⁢ meatballs generously into each roll, ensuring some marinara ‌sauce ‍drips over for juiciness.
  7. layer two slices of provolone ‌cheese atop the⁢ meatballs ⁣in each sandwich.
  8. Place the assembled subs on a baking sheet and broil in your⁣ oven for 2-3 minutes or until the⁢ provolone melts into a ⁣creamy blanket. Watch closely to avoid‌ burning.
  9. Remove from oven, garnish with fresh ‌basil leaves, and season with freshly cracked black pepper to ‌finish.
  10. Serve immediately for the ultimate comforting and savory experience.

Chef’s Tips‍ for Success

  • Choosing meats: Opt for ⁣pre-cooked meatballs with ​a robust​ seasoning profile-Italian‍ herbs and ⁢a balance of pork and beef​ often⁢ yield the juiciest results.
  • Marinara magic: ⁢ To elevate a store-bought sauce, infuse ‌it ‍with‌ sautéed garlic and onion, fresh herbs, and a ⁢touch of red pepper flakes for a homemade flair.
  • Melt method: The quick broil technique ensures provolone melts perfectly without making the bread soggy-a​ critical balance‌ for texture.
  • Make-ahead: Prepare the marinara and meatballs ahead of time, then ‌assemble and broil at mealtime ‌for effortless hosting.
  • Variations: Try swapping provolone for mozzarella ‍or adding​ sautéed peppers and mushrooms for extra flavor⁢ complexity.

Serving Suggestions

Present these ‌subs alongside a ‍crisp, peppery⁢ arugula salad​ dressed with ⁣lemon vinaigrette or classic garlic parmesan ⁤fries for‍ a⁤ diner-style ⁢feast. A sprinkle ⁤of ⁣grated parmesan ⁣and⁤ additional fresh⁤ basil leaves atop the subs adds ⁣vibrant color and‍ aroma that invite you in.​ For drinks, a chilled ​Italian red wine‍ or ‍sparkling lemonade complements ‌the rich⁢ flavors beautifully.
